Former Bafana Bafana coach Pitso Mosimane has praised Walid Regragui after he guided Morocco to the first African nation to reach the World Cup semifinals.

This comes after Morocco edged Portugal 1-0 to become the first African country to reach the semifinals of the World Cup on Saturday.

Following this achievement, Mosimane thanked Regragui for “putting all of Africa in the global map”.

“Walid, thank you for putting all of Africa in the Global Map,” wrote the former Al Ahly and Mamelodi Sundowns on social media.

“Thank you for educating most of our Federations in our beloved Continent that we have potential and we got wiser and we now a lot about Global Football and we can compete with any country if we plan properly.”

Morocco will now meet defending champions France in the semifinals on Wednesday.

Argentina and Croatia will meet in the other semifinals on Tuesday.

The final will be played on Sunday.
